Squeaky floorboards are normal with temperature changes. … WebApr 6, 2024 · You can try sprinkling talcum powder or powder graphite into the joints. Then place a cloth over the floorboards and make sure the lubricant goes into the cracks. This helps to reduce the friction between planks and silence small squeaks. To remove the remains of the lubricant, just use a vacuum cleaner or damp cloth.

WebOct 21, 2024 · The most common way is to lift the flooring where the squeak is occurring and identify if the sub-flooring requires a few more nails/needs evening out. Alternatively, you can go under the flooring and apply wedges into any noticeable gaps. In some cases, joists can shrink, warp, or twist, resulting in rather large gaps under the sub-floor. Using 2” finish nails and a hammer you can nail down wood flooring boards that are moving and causing squeaks. Be sure to only nail along the joists that support your floor.
